Re: pic: Bumpers

Quote:
Originally Posted by Rosiebotboss View Post
Pretty! Nice job.

But, I hate to be a pain, but the Inspector in me says at first glance the numbers do not meet the 3/4 stroke width. Am I wrong?

<R09> Teams shall display their team number on the BUMPERS in four locations at approximately 90° intervals around the perimeter of the ROBOT. The numerals must be at least 4” high, at least in ¾” stroke width and in a contrasting color from its background.

I just looked at that (thank you for the warning) and saw that at the thicker points the numbers are indeed at around 3/4". The I don't think that the thinner parts should make these bumbers illeagal, largely because in the privous years we have had numbers on the bumpers that are thinner and harder to see and "got away with it"
